Saline hydrides (also known as ionic hydrides or pseudohalides) are compounds form between hydrogen and the most active metals, especially with the alkali and alkaline-earth metals of group one and two elements. In chemistry, hydronium (hydroxonium in traditional British English) is the common name for the cation [H 3 O] +, also written as H 3 O +, the type of oxonium ion produced by protonation of water. Strictly speaking, the term hydride refers to ionic compounds of hydrogen with the electropositive metals of Groups 1-2; these contain the hydride ion, H -, and are often referred to as "true" hydrides. At one extreme, all compounds containing covalently bound H atoms are called hydrides: water (H 2 O) is a hydride of oxygen, ammonia is a hydride of nitrogen, etc. A compound that can donate a proton (a hydrogen ion) to another compound is called a Brønsted-Lowry acid. The hydrogen anion is an important constituent of the atmosphere of stars, such as the Sun. In fact, cells spend much of the energy Arrhenius defined an acid as a compound that increases the concentration of hydrogen ion (H +) in aqueous solution. Similarly, Arrhenius defined a base as a compound that increases the concentration of hydroxide ion (OH −) in aqueous solution.e. The title mentions H Mart, a North-American … Typically, a . Active transport mechanisms do just this, expending energy (often in the form of ATP) to maintain the right concentrations of ions and molecules in living cells.
